BASKETBALL WORK BEGINS.

One Hundred and Fifteen Candidates.--Practice Monday.

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

One hundred and fifteen men answered the call for candidates for the basketball team last evening. This squad, which is the largest that ever came out, will be increased on Monday night, as there are a number of men who were unable to report last night, but have signified their intention of playing.

Regular practice for the University squad will be held on Mondays, Wednesdays, and Fridays throughout the season, beginning Monday night, when the men are expected to report at the Gymnasium promptly at 7.15. The squad will consist of the more experienced of last year's players, and a second team will be picked from the most promising new men Class teams will also be chosen and a regular interclass series played before the Christmas vacation. Class numerals and silver cups will be given to the team winning the class championship. Strict training will begin after the Christmas recess and the first game will be played with Massachusetts State College on January 10.

The Freshman squad will have regular practice on Tuesday and Thursday evenings at 7.15, and a schedule of ten games has been provided for, ending with the Yale freshmen at New Haven on March 7.
